MasterChef Competition Update
Ready to indulge in culinary competition? MasterChef Canada enthusiasts may need to adjust their viewing expectations.
The popular Canadian cooking competition aired its seventh season back in 2021 on CTV. While the network hasn't officially cancelled the series, there's been no announcement regarding an eighth season, and prospects currently appear slim.
For those craving MasterChef content, all seven seasons of the Canadian version remain available for streaming on CTV's platform. However, accessing this content requires valid Canadian cable provider credentials, as CTV doesn't offer a standalone streaming subscription option.
Canadian viewers traveling abroad can still access their favorite cooking competition by using a Virtual Private Network (VPN) with Canadian servers to maintain access to their CTV account.
